Understanding Retatrutide ZPHC 120mg and its Mechanism of Action
Retatrutide drug ZPHC, a innovative dual stimulator for glucagon-like peptide-1 and glucose-dependent insulinotropic polypeptide , signifies a potentially beneficial treatment for addressing type 2 diabetes . Its distinct mechanism of functionality comprises binding to and activating both receptors implicated in glycemic homeostasis and insulin release . This combined effect contributes to enhanced glycemic control , weight loss , and potential cardiovascular benefits . Researchers hypothesize that the concurrent action on these mechanisms delivers a more holistic solution than targeting either target individually . Further investigations are continuing to thoroughly determine the long-term performance and safety data of Retatrutide ZPHC.
